Salah scores, Egypt downs New Zealand 3-1 for 1st World Cup victory
VANCOUVER — Mohamed Salah scored the go-ahead goal and Egypt went on to defeat New Zealand 3-1 on Sunday night and secure its first-ever World Cup win. Egypt down New Zealand, take command of Group G
(Photo credit: Anne-Marie Sorvin-Imagn Images)Liverpool star Mohamed Salah scored his first goal of the tournament as part of a second-half flurry to deliver Egypt their first World Cup victory, 3-1 over New Zealand on Sunday night in Vancouver.Both Salah and Mostafa Zico tallied a goal and an assist as Egypt (1-0-1, 4 points) rallied from a 1-0 halftime hole and took over first place in Group G.
